An image of an object placed in front of a convex mirror formed 8 cm away. If the focal length of the mirror is 16 cm, calculate the distance of the object from the mirror.
Given
Focal length of convex mirror = +16cm (focal length of convex mirror is positive)
The distance of image = + 8cm (Since in case of a convex mirror, the image is always virtual)
The distance of Object = ?

U = -16 cm
Hence, the object is placed at a distance of 16cm in front of the mirror.
